LENR Research |
The study of low energy nuclear reaction (LENR) research, historically referred to as cold fusion, is one of the most misunderstood subjects in science. LENR research falls within the field of condensed matter nuclear science. When it entered the public spotlight in 1989, the cold fusion controversy was the center of great drama, excitement and even outright hostility - unlike any other science story in recent memory.
Although many skeptical scientists, typically physicists, wrote the entire phenomenon off as pathological science in 1989, a persistent group of researchers including chemists, physicists and metallurgists recognized that a new phenomenon of nature had indeed been revealed by Martin Fleischmann and Stanley Pons at the University of Utah.
